Source: ChainalysisGhana has officially legalized cryptocurrency trading with the passage of the Virtual Asset Service Providers Bill. The new law establishes a clear regulatory framework for crypto activities, giving the Bank of Ghana (BoG) the authority to license and supervise crypto asset service providers (CASPs). According to BoG Governor Johnson Asiama, this move ensures that crypto trading can operate safely while protecting consumers from fraud, money laundering, and systemic risks. For the first time, crypto traders in Ghana can operate legally without fear of arrest.
